Which geographic feature is identified as the longest river in the United States?

Missouri River

The Missouri River is recognized as the longest river in the United States, stretching approximately 2,341 miles. It flows primarily through the central United States, starting in Montana and eventually merging with the Mississippi River in St. Louis, Missouri. Its significant length and the extensive watershed it drains make it a prominent geographic feature of the U.S.
